Transaction 5858ae351bf09b2f14162fe054b8a51e3b5dfa833793cd394f40b8cc44cac1ef

1 Input
2 Outputs
  • 5858ae351bf09b2f14162fe054b8a51e3b5dfa833793cd394f40b8cc44cac1ef:0
  • value  2331515
    address  3AtWDN1gF7yMqKr81RhH5qGcSPYCthe8tJ
  • 5858ae351bf09b2f14162fe054b8a51e3b5dfa833793cd394f40b8cc44cac1ef:1
  • value  7264240
    address  3FUmWjQviDouEtZXkXMsbCApXNSrWdpSSu